About Thrive

Since 2016, Thrive Early Learning Centres has experienced significant success and growth. We are founded by our clear vision ‘Being committed to children’s futures through creating lifelong learning experiences through a rich and stimulating learning environment where children and their families feel secure and supported’.

We currently have 12 operating centres across NSW and VIC, catering for children aged 6 weeks to 5 years of age.

We are entirely Australian and privately owned and operated, employing over 300 professionals and supporting over 2,500 children.

About The Role

We are looking for an early childhood educator with a completed Certificate III qualification to join the team.

We are looking for a professional with experience in programming and the ability to inspire, motivate and maintain a positive learning culture within the centre for children, families and educators.

Your main responsibilities will be to:

  • Build and maintain meaningful relationships with children, families and colleagues.
  • Have sound knowledge of and demonstrate high-quality practice in line with the Early Years Learning Framework (EYLF).
  • Work in positive collaboration with all members of the team.
  • Maintain effective communication with parents/carers.
  • Actively contribute to the educational program through conversations, observations, and documentation.

The successful candidate will have:

  • A completed Certificate III or diploma qualification in Early Childhood Education and Care
  • A current NSW Employee Working With Children’s Check
  • Sound and practical working knowledge of the Early Years Learning Framework (EYLF) & National Quality Standard (NQS)
